Output 75fb56f7929312d2c8d3defbfc628d782e9ddce97ea30d2d8849e2bfb95f933a:0

value
813079
script pubkey
OP_0 OP_PUSHBYTES_20 dc6e344276435eab95c5face58a7a01bb4a740ed
address
bc1qm3hrgsnkgd02h9w9lt893faqrw62ws8dmn24uk
transaction
75fb56f7929312d2c8d3defbfc628d782e9ddce97ea30d2d8849e2bfb95f933a
confirmations
214432
spent
true